.Contact-module__5phd-G__section{background:var(--background);min-height:100vh;margin-top:2rem;padding:2rem 0}.Contact-module__5phd-G__container{max-width:1200px;margin:0 auto;padding:0 20px}.Contact-module__5phd-G__header{text-align:center;margin-bottom:4rem;padding-top:2rem}.Contact-module__5phd-G__subtitle{color:var(--cta);text-transform:uppercase;letter-spacing:1px;margin-bottom:.5rem;font-size:1.1rem;font-weight:600}.Contact-module__5phd-G__title{color:var(--text-primary);margin-bottom:1rem;font-size:3rem;font-weight:700}.Contact-module__5phd-G__description{color:var(--text-primary);opacity:.9;max-width:600px;margin:0 auto;font-size:1.2rem;line-height:1.6}.Contact-module__5phd-G__columns{grid-template-columns:2fr 1fr;align-items:start;gap:4rem;display:grid}.Contact-module__5phd-G__leftColumn{flex-direction:column;gap:2rem;display:flex}.Contact-module__5phd-G__rightColumn{position:sticky;top:100px}.Contact-module__5phd-G__contactBlocks{flex-direction:column;gap:2rem;display:flex}.Contact-module__5phd-G__contactBlock{background:var(--card-bg);border:1px solid var(--border-color);border-radius:12px;padding:2rem;transition:all .3s;box-shadow:0 4px 20px #0000000d}.Contact-module__5phd-G__contactBlock:hover{transform:translateY(-2px);box-shadow:0 8px 30px #0000001a}.Contact-module__5phd-G__blockTitle{color:var(--text-primary);border-bottom:2px solid var(--cta);margin-bottom:1.5rem;padding-bottom:.5rem;font-size:1.5rem;font-weight:600}.Contact-module__5phd-G__featureList{flex-direction:column;gap:1rem;list-style:none;display:flex}.Contact-module__5phd-G__featureItem{color:var(--text-primary);align-items:flex-start;gap:1rem;line-height:1.5;display:flex}.Contact-module__5phd-G__featureItem .Contact-module__5phd-G__icon{flex-shrink:0;margin-top:.1rem;font-size:1.2rem}.Contact-module__5phd-G__timings{flex-direction:column;gap:1.5rem;display:flex}.Contact-module__5phd-G__doctorTiming{border-bottom:1px solid var(--border-color);padding-bottom:1.5rem}.Contact-module__5phd-G__doctorTiming:last-of-type{border-bottom:none;padding-bottom:0}.Contact-module__5phd-G__doctorHeader{justify-content:space-between;align-items:center;margin-bottom:.5rem;display:flex}.Contact-module__5phd-G__doctorName{color:var(--text-primary);margin:0;font-size:1.1rem;font-weight:600}.Contact-module__5phd-G__contactIcons{gap:.5rem;display:flex}.Contact-module__5phd-G__whatsappIcon,.Contact-module__5phd-G__phoneIcon{border-radius:8px;justify-content:center;align-items:center;width:40px;height:40px;text-decoration:none;transition:all .3s;display:flex}.Contact-module__5phd-G__whatsappIcon{color:#fff;background:#25d366;font-size:1.2rem}.Contact-module__5phd-G__whatsappIcon:hover{background:#1da851}.Contact-module__5phd-G__phoneIcon{background:var(--cta);color:#fff;font-size:1.1rem}.Contact-module__5phd-G__phoneIcon:hover{background:#7a0303}.Contact-module__5phd-G__phoneNumber{color:var(--text-primary);margin-bottom:.5rem;font-weight:500}.Contact-module__5phd-G__timingSlot{color:var(--text-primary);opacity:.9;font-size:.9rem}.Contact-module__5phd-G__closedInfo{background:var(--secondary-bg);text-align:center;border-radius:8px;padding:1rem}.Contact-module__5phd-G__closedInfo p{color:var(--text-primary);margin:.25rem 0}.Contact-module__5phd-G__formBlock{background:var(--card-bg);border:1px solid var(--border-color);border-radius:12px;padding:2rem}.Contact-module__5phd-G__contactForm{flex-direction:column;gap:1.5rem;display:flex}.Contact-module__5phd-G__formGroup{flex-direction:column;display:flex}.Contact-module__5phd-G__formInput,.Contact-module__5phd-G__formTextarea{border:1px solid var(--border-color);background:var(--secondary-bg);color:var(--text-primary);border-radius:8px;padding:1rem;font-family:inherit;font-size:1rem;transition:all .3s}.Contact-module__5phd-G__formInput:focus,.Contact-module__5phd-G__formTextarea:focus{border-color:var(--cta);outline:none;box-shadow:0 0 0 3px #9104041a}.Contact-module__5phd-G__formTextarea{resize:vertical;min-height:120px}.Contact-module__5phd-G__submitButton{background:var(--cta);color:#fff;cursor:pointer;border:none;border-radius:8px;padding:1rem 2rem;font-size:1rem;font-weight:600;transition:all .3s}.Contact-module__5phd-G__submitButton:hover{background:#7a0303}.Contact-module__5phd-G__mapContainer{background:var(--card-bg);border:1px solid var(--border-color);border-radius:12px;padding:2rem;box-shadow:0 4px 20px #0000000d}.Contact-module__5phd-G__mapTitle{color:var(--text-primary);text-align:center;margin-bottom:1.5rem;font-size:1.5rem;font-weight:600}.Contact-module__5phd-G__mapWrapper{border-radius:8px;margin-bottom:1rem;overflow:hidden;box-shadow:0 4px 15px #0000001a}.Contact-module__5phd-G__mapIframe{border:none;width:100%;height:300px}.Contact-module__5phd-G__mapInfo{text-align:center;color:var(--text-primary)}.Contact-module__5phd-G__mapInfo p{opacity:.9;margin:0}@media (max-width:1024px){.Contact-module__5phd-G__columns{grid-template-columns:1fr;gap:3rem}.Contact-module__5phd-G__rightColumn{position:static}}@media (max-width:768px){.Contact-module__5phd-G__section{padding:1rem 0}.Contact-module__5phd-G__title{font-size:2.5rem}.Contact-module__5phd-G__description{font-size:1.1rem}.Contact-module__5phd-G__contactBlock,.Contact-module__5phd-G__formBlock,.Contact-module__5phd-G__mapContainer{padding:1.5rem}.Contact-module__5phd-G__doctorHeader{flex-direction:column;align-items:flex-start;gap:1rem}.Contact-module__5phd-G__contactIcons{align-self:flex-start}}@media (max-width:480px){.Contact-module__5phd-G__title{font-size:2rem}.Contact-module__5phd-G__subtitle{font-size:1rem}.Contact-module__5phd-G__blockTitle{font-size:1.3rem}.Contact-module__5phd-G__contactBlock,.Contact-module__5phd-G__formBlock,.Contact-module__5phd-G__mapContainer{padding:1rem}.Contact-module__5phd-G__featureItem{font-size:.9rem}}
